Columbus Blue Jackets Prepare for NHL Draft

The Columbus Blue Jackets are gearing up for the NHL draft, with a potential pick at No. 14 overall.

What are the options for the Blue Jackets?

Oscar Hemming, a 6-4, 204-pound center from Finland, has risen to the top of consensus draft rankings, with six of 10 mock drafts listing him as a potential fit for the Blue Jackets.

He dominated the junior ranks in Finland two seasons ago and played 19 games at Boston College last year, posting eight points as the youngest player in college hockey.

Why is Hemming a strong candidate?

Hemming's combination of size and ability makes him an attractive pick for the Blue Jackets, who are looking to add depth to their roster.

Corey Pronman of The Athletic projects Hemming to be picked by the Blue Jackets, citing his physicality and talent as a key factor.

What other players are in the mix?

Malte Gustafsson, a big Swedish defenseman, has also been rising up draft projections after his showing at the NHL Combine, but may be gone by the time the Jackets pick.

The Blue Jackets' GM, Don Waddell, has stated that he is open to a potential trade to help the team win now, adding an element of uncertainty to the draft.

Adam Fantilli, Kirill Marchenko, and Sean Monahan are among the key players on the Blue Jackets' roster, with Hemming potentially fitting in with this group.
